This Position reports to:


Division President Process Industries

As Division Automation Manager - Process Industries, you'll lead the charge in shaping the future of automation - driving strategic growth, innovation, and transformation across all business lines.

Core responsibilities:

Strategic Alignment & Target Setting

Coordinate market and competitive analysis efforts, in collaboration with Strategic Marketing, PCP, and Strategy Develop and maintain an automation strategy in coordination with all Business Lines and aligned with divisional and corporate goals Develop and maintain a mid-segment product strategy Define clear automation targets per business line Build and maintain global dashboards to monitor KPIs across the division

Technology & Innovation



Identify growth potential resulting from introduction of new technology (AV) and reflect in targets Steer automation technology development to enhance competitiveness of our solutions across differentiated market segments Keep alignment between Business Line/Division automation product roadmaps and PCP roadmaps in terms of content and timing Prepare the organization for a timely introduction of new technologies

Organizational Design & Efficiency



Establish clear mandates, reporting lines, and decision-making structures Lead a global, core automation growth team to support and coordinate with Business Lines to effectively position automation in the appropriate industry verticals

Project Management & Lifecycle Excellence



Strengthen project management capabilities within automation, being the link between Business Line needs and PCP Implement robust lifecycle management practices for automation solutions

Cross-Functional Collaboration



Ensure strong alignment with PCP, Digital, B&R, and GPB Develop and coordinate cross-functional and cross-Business Line initiatives to support automation growth (e.g. installed base management, ASM growth, modernization plans, etc.) Evaluate new opportunities and manage customer lifecycle risks

Change Management & Vision Execution



Lead the transformation toward the Automation Vision Implement structured change management programs to support adoption

Talent Development & Sustainability



Build a sustainable structure that does not rely solely on legacy knowledge Enhance automation capabilities through competence mapping and training Build an effective, capable, and high-performing organization

Key requirements:


To be successful in this role, you bring around 15 years of experience in a similar capacity with deep expertise in automation. Your educational background is rooted in electrical or automation engineering. You have demonstrated strength in business strategy, collaboration, market intelligence, and developing effective go-to-market approaches. You are experienced in driving customer success and ensuring regulatory and legal compliance. You know how to define and deliver on performance targets, enable sales organizations, and accelerate business development and adoption.


You are also highly skilled in change management and channel sales, and you understand how to manage operations and projects at a global scale. Your ability to work across functions and business lines while leading complex initiatives positions you as a trusted driver of transformation within a global industrial organization.
